For the scenario where a population of rabbits doubles every year, you can represent the increase after five years in two ways:

  1. As repeated multiplication: This is essentially multiplying 2 by itself for each of the five years of growth:

    • Question Blank 1 of 2: 2 • 2 • 2 • 2 • 2
  2. As an exponential expression: In this case, since the population doubles every year, after five years, the population can be expressed as \( 2^5 \).

    • Question Blank 2 of 2: 2^5
